Study Notes
Importance of Effective Communication in Evangelism
- Effective communication is essential for evangelists to share their message and connect with the audience.
- Understanding the audience's needs, interests, and beliefs allows for message tailoring, enhancing relevance.
- Building connections through trust, empathy, and rapport facilitates a welcoming environment for dialogue.
- Clarity in messaging ensures the core message is conveyed without confusion, using simple and direct language.
- Non-verbal communication—including body language, gestures, and tone—significantly impacts audience receptiveness.
- Adapting to different communication styles enhances the ability to reach diverse individuals.
- Active listening promotes understanding of audience needs and allows for personalized guidance.
Tools and Techniques for Effective Evangelistic Messages
- Storytelling: Engages the audience emotionally; relatable and heartfelt narratives enhance message receptivity.
- Visual Aids: Images, videos, and infographics simplify complex concepts, making messages more memorable and accessible.
- Digital Media Utilization: Platforms like social media broaden reach; engaging content like videos and podcasts attracts diverse audiences.
- Interactive Presentations: Activities and discussions foster participation and deeper personal connections with the message.
- Clear and Concise Language: Avoids jargon, ensuring messages are straightforward and quickly understood by the audience.
- Active Listening: Acknowledges audience feedback, demonstrating respect and empathy; allows for tailored responses to concerns.
Building Relationships and Connecting with the Audience
- Understanding Your Audience: Research their demographics, interests, and cultural contexts to frame messages effectively.
- Active Listening: Shows genuine interest; reflective listening builds rapport by valuing audience perspectives.
- Establishing Rapport: Comfortable interactions facilitated through friendly gestures, eye contact, and a genuine tone encourage engagement.
- Creating Meaningful Dialogue: Open-ended questions invite thoughtful audience participation, enhancing mutual understanding.
- Using Storytelling: Personal anecdotes evoke empathy and connect emotionally, strengthening audience ties.
- Non-Verbal Communication: Positive cues like smiling and open posture create a warm atmosphere, fostering audience connection.
- Building Trust: Integrity and authenticity are crucial; consistency in actions promotes long-lasting relationships.
- Adapting and Flexibility: Adjust messaging and delivery based on audience feedback; flexibility supports better engagement and connection.
